What to Look for in circuit tester for solar panel setups

Picking the wrong circuit tester for solar panel setups wastes time and can lead to misdiagnosing a dead panel or reversed polarity. The biggest mistake I see is people buying a tester that only works on AC voltage or has a range too low to handle their solar array. Here’s what actually matters when you’re shopping.

Voltage Range

This is the most important spec because your solar panels and batteries run on DC voltage, and you need a tester that covers that range. Most residential panels output between 12V and 48V DC, but if you wire panels in series, you can easily hit 60V or more. I always recommend getting a tester rated at least up to 60V, and if you’re building a larger system, look for one that goes to 70V or 120V. A tester with a 3-48V range works fine for basic 12V and 24V setups, but it won’t cut it for bigger arrays.

Polarity Indication

Solar panels are DC devices, so positive and negative matter — a lot. Hook up a panel backwards and your charge controller won’t work, and you could damage equipment. A good tester should have a dual-color polarity indicator, usually red for positive and green or blue for negative, so you can see at a glance which wire is which. Some testers also use a bidirectional design that automatically detects polarity no matter how you connect the leads, which saves time when you’re probing tight spaces.

Display Type and Readability

You’ll often be testing panels in direct sunlight, so a display that washes out in bright light is useless. Look for a tester with a digital LED or backlit LCD display that stays readable outdoors. The number should be large enough to read without squinting, and ideally it updates fast so you can see voltage changes as you probe different connections. A simple analog light bulb tester won’t give you the precise voltage reading you need for troubleshooting solar systems.

Probe Quality and Build

The probe is what actually makes contact with your wires and terminals, so it needs to be sharp, durable, and long enough to reach into crowded junction boxes. A stainless steel probe resists corrosion and stays sharp longer than cheaper alternatives. I also pay attention to the wire length — a longer spring wire, like 140 inches, lets you test connections that are far apart without stretching the tool to its limit. A tester that feels flimsy in your hand will probably break after a few drops on a concrete roof.

Buzzer or Audible Alert

Some testers include a buzzer that beeps when they detect continuity or voltage, which is surprisingly useful when you’re working in a noisy environment or can’t keep your eyes on the display. If you’re frequently testing connections on a roof with wind or traffic noise, an audible alert means you don’t have to stop and look at the screen every time. The trade-off is that some buzzers can’t be turned off, so they get annoying during extended testing sessions.

Bidirectional vs. Standard Testing

A standard tester requires you to connect the ground clip to a known negative source before probing, which works fine but adds an extra step. Bidirectional testers automatically detect polarity regardless of which lead you connect first, so you can just clip and probe without thinking about orientation. This is a nice convenience feature, but it’s not essential — a standard tester with a clear polarity indicator does the same job for less money. Only pay extra for bidirectional if you value speed over savings.

What voltage range do I need for testing solar panels?

For most residential solar setups, you want a tester that covers at least 3-60V DC. A standard 12V panel puts out around 18V open-circuit, and a 24V system can hit 36V or more. What’s the difference between a standard test light and a digital circuit tester?

A standard test light just glows when it detects voltage — it tells you power is present but not how much. Can a circuit tester check if my solar panel is outputting power?

Yes, that’s exactly what these testers do. Connect the ground clip to the negative terminal of your panel, then touch the probe to the positive terminal — the display will show the open-circuit voltage.
